The 23-year-old's arrest in Eagle Pass comes after his statutory rape and possession of child pornography conviction in Missouri last year, officials said.
A convicted child sex offender was arrested near the Texas border last week following his deportation in 2022, officials said.The U.S. Border Patrol announced that 23-year-old Celso Noe Chacon-Arriaga from Honduras was detained near Eagle Pass on June 28.
Following his arrest, records revealed Chacon-Arriaga was convicted last year of statutory rape and possession of child pornography in a Missouri case. The agency said the convicted felon was sentenced to seven years of confinement and was most recently deported in 2022. Chacon-Arriaga now faces a charge of re-entry after deportation, which officials say carries a maximum sentence of up to 20 years in prison.
